4. Loans To Consolidate Debts

Debt consolidation is another strategy that has helped out hundreds of people in paying their debts. This is applicable if you are just beginning to face financial difficulties and are still keeping a good credit score. In a debt consolidation loan, you will be rolling all your debts into one single account for repayment. This would also mean lower interest rates.

5. Debt Settlement

Finally, you should check out those solutions which have become popular because of sagging economy. Debt settlement is one example of such a relief option. In the past, debt settlement was not very popular because it causes a lot of loss for the credit card issuer and that the reduction in the credit score was not good option for the average borrower.

However, the economy is in such a poor state that both the lenders and the borrowers are prepared to overlook the negative aspects. You should consider this option to get debt relief on a permanent basis.
